Cybersecurity Startup Cyemptive Nabs $3.5M Investment

Seattle-area cybersecurity startup Cyemptive has just come out of stealth mode with the announcement of a $3.5 million funding round. So reports GeekWire.

The company’s executives include alumni of the National Security Agency, Microsoft and Hitachi. Cyemptive, which didn’t disclose its investors, makes software that it called an “automatic self-repairing reliable platform.”
